Banham Hurts Knee, Out For Rest Of Gophers Season

MINNEAPOLIS (AP) — Minnesota senior point guard Rachel Banham will miss the rest of the season after injuring her right knee.

Coach Marlene Stollings made the announcement Thursday.

Stollings says Banham suffered a torn ACL in her knee Wednesday in the first half of the Gophers' win at North Dakota.

Banham was the Big Ten player of the year pick.

Stollings released a statement on the injury Friday.

"This is a devastating injury for Rachel and a great loss for our team. Rachel has been a joy to coach and has put in the work to elevate her game to yet another level this season. We will support her throughout her rehabilitation process and she will continue to play a critical leadership role on this team as she recovers," Stollings said.
